Oldest Holocaust Survivor in Israel Passes Away at Age 107

Orthodox Jewish men gather at Mount of Olives Cemetery in Jerusalem, Israel, under a clear sky.

The oldest known Holocaust survivor residing in Israel has passed away at the age of 107, according to recent media reports. The passing of this remarkable individual marks the fading of a direct link to one of the darkest chapters in modern human history.
